I need a function which allows me to change the stop loss "side".

I will give an example: when you set a pending long order with a predefined stop loss, by default the platform sets the stop loss at bid. I would like to have the stop loss set at ask.

When I use the Stop Loss block of the Visual JF and change the side setting to "opposite side", it still sets the stop loss at bid, and not at ask as I would like it to be.

My request is if you can upload a vfs file showing how I can change the stop loss side from bid to ask as I tried everything and it always sets the SL at bid. Thank you very much in advance!

Unfortunately the function of choosing trigger side is not working in Set Stop Loss block.
By now it is impossible to set trigger side in stop loss orders from Visual.
We are working on the fix of the issue.

When you have your strategy Visual JForex ready, if you want you can hack the generated java code using the editor in jforex platform very carefully:

This explanation won't be enough if you have no experience coding but the essential is this:

Find the the stop loss block(s) that you want to change in the code and there you'll see something similar to this:

argument_1.setStopLossPrice(stopLoss);

Then you can modify the line to set the BID or ASK side as you wish modifying like this:

argument_1.setStopLossPrice(stopLoss, OfferSide.BID);

Or like this:

argument_1.setStopLossPrice(stopLoss, OfferSide.ASK);

Then you have to compile the code and test it very carefully with the backtest module and use a demo account to confirm that works properly.

Remember, use this information at your own risk!
